Tour Highlights
Embark on an immersive journey through the captivating world of ‘Outlander’ as you explore iconic filming locations like Doune Castle and Blackness Castle on a guided tour in Edinburgh.
These castles hold immense historical significance, with Doune Castle dating back to the 13th century and Blackness Castle being a formidable fortress on the Firth of Forth.
As you visit these stunning sites, you’ll gain fascinating filming insights into how they were transformed into key locations in the Outlander series.
The tour provides a unique opportunity to step into the world of Claire and Jamie Fraser, experiencing firsthand the magic of these historical landmarks brought to life through the lens of the camera.
